About the role

  • The position works with the Sales leadership team in driving key initiatives and helping the Flowserve to achieve its goals and maximize sales bookings and opportunity pipelines.

Responsibilities

  • Lead coordination efforts on applicable aftermarket quotes while ensuring close collaboration and communication with all applicable stakeholders.
  • Drive daily tactical customer proposals in addition to support strategic offerings, as well as identified sales win back opportunities.
  • Partner with Site Hubs to drive quotation performance within region, and across the aligned product sites, while fully leveraging quoting tools for prioritization, quicker cycle times, shortened parts delivery times, and minimization of rework.
  • Manage and monitor the proposal throughout the entire bid cycle including updating and maintaining designated workload management tool, while monitoring hit-rate optimization.
  • Maintain current, accurate and organized records of sales training, organization charts as well as other critical pieces of information needed to manage the sales engagement.
  • The Sales Support Representative (SSR) is the primary point of contact for the customer and collaborates with Engineering, Manufacturing, Quality, and other departments to respond to customer inquiries.
  • The SSR will use data as a strategic asset to provide decision support, accurate planning of sales quota forecasting, and sales productivity reporting and efficiency analysis.
  • Review customer specifications and documents to apply current Flowserve technical and commercial requirements.
  • Support 30 day/ quarterly sales forecast and monthly outlook processes.
